Do you remember The Secret World fanfic author Amber “Blodwedd Mallory” McKee? She’s an author who was given the go-ahead by Funcom to write, publish, and sell a series of unofficial novels using the game’s IP, starting with To Sir with Love, London Underground, and Dead in the Water. Now she has a fourth book in her series that takes us on a new adventure in The Secret World with a new protagonist.

Into the Inferno follows the escapades of Dragon agent Renee Hadad Laveau, a man with anger issues tasked with tracking down a magus who has helped open fiery rifts at Red Oak Beach while also training new agent Saffey Williams.

“In a secret world where everything is true and old gods roam the Earth, Hadad and Saffey must work together to find where the portal magus has opened the door to the hell dimensions and left it open. Failure will mean the end of everything. Hadad thinks he’s in hell. Turns out he’s about to be right.”

In addition to this new entry in the series, McKee plans on writing more books based on the Templar faction as well as a third storyline centered around the Illuminati faction. For now, fans can pick up the latest book in digital and paperback formats.
